Embodiment 1

[0021] A solar photovoltaic panel rain shielding device, comprising a mounting bracket 1, a photovoltaic panel protection mechanism is provided under the mounting bracket 1, and the photovoltaic panel protection mechanism includes a shelter cloth retractor 3 provided at the bottom of the mounting bracket 1. The shielding cloth retractor 3 includes a cylindrical housing 31 in which a clockwork spring 32 is fixed, and a shielding cloth 33 is wound on the outside of the clockwork spring 32. One end of the shielding cloth 33 extends out of the housing 31 A driving mechanism 2 for driving the shielding cloth 33 to shield the photovoltaic panel is connected to the end.

Embodiment 2

[0023] On the basis of embodiment 1, the drive mechanism 2 includes two sets of symmetrically arranged single drive components, the single drive component 2 includes a sliding block 21, and two sides of the mounting bracket 1 are provided with sliding grooves 11, so The slider 21 is adapted to the chute 11 and can move along the length of the chute 11 in the chute 11. A support block 22 is provided on the outside of the slider 21, and a top plate 23 is provided above the support block 22. Abstract

The invention discloses a solar photovoltaic panel rain-shedding device. The solar photovoltaic panel rain-shedding device comprises a mounting bracket, wherein a photovoltaic panel protection mechanism is disposed under the mounting bracket, the photovoltaic panel protection mechanism comprises a shielding cloth retractor disposed at a bottom of the mounting bracket, the shielding cloth retractorcomprises a cylindrical outer casing, a spring is fixed in the outer casing, the spring is externally wrapped with a shielding cloth, and one end of the shielding cloth protrudes out of the outer casing and is connected at the end with a driving mechanism used for driving the shielding cloth to block a photovoltaic panel. The solar photovoltaic panel rain-shedding device is advantaged in that through arranging the shielding cloth retractor and the driving mechanism, the driving mechanism starts to pull out the shielding cloth to block the photovoltaic panel in a rainy day, after the rain stops, the shielding cloth is retracted, influence of the rain on the photovoltaic panel is avoided, and service life of the photovoltaic panel is improved.

Technical field [0001] The invention relates to the field of new energy devices, in particular to a solar photovoltaic panel rain shielding device. Background technique [0002] As a new type of energy, solar energy is an inexhaustible renewable resource. In the urgent form of the increasingly scarce tangible energy on the earth, solar photovoltaic power generation has become a new energy project of global concern and key development. In the long-term energy strategy China has a very important position. As a new type of clean energy, solar photovoltaic power stations are developing rapidly all over the world. Photovoltaic power generation requires a huge number of photovoltaic power generation panels to form a solar cell array. In rainy weather, solar photovoltaic panels cannot absorb sufficient sunlight.
